As a clinician working within Specsavers Audiology, you’ll focus on delivering personalised hearing care through comprehensive assessments, fittings, and ongoing support. Reporting to the Audiology Partner, you’ll benefit from ongoing clinical support and professional development, while thriving in a fast-paced environment that values initiative, autonomy, and strong relationships with our in-store retail teams.
In this role, you’ll be working across our Mt Hutton, Charlestown and Tuggerah stores, offering variety and diversity while playing a vital role in expanding access to quality hearing care across multiple local communities.
Full-time and part-time opportunities are available, with a strong preference for candidates able to work full-time across all three locations. For full-time roles, the preferred roster is Tuesday to Saturday, with the option of a weekly or fortnightly schedule.

About Specsavers Audiology:
Since launching in Australia in 2017 and New Zealand in 2019, Specsavers Audiology has been transforming hearing care by making high-quality solutions more accessible through transparent pricing and affordable technology, removing barriers that have traditionally prevented many people from seeking help. As a clinician, you’ll play a key role in delivering the exceptional care that has helped Specsavers grow into a trusted global brand since 1984.
